I think some poor excuses for our loss. It's greens fault for taking Burns out and Wigan was offside when charged the kick down.

We made two school boy errors and Wigan punished us for them. Turner not in position for the kick that was charged down. We been charged down constantly this year and im amazed KC and the coaching staff haven't addressed this.

Poor decision by robes passing it to Richards on last tackle in our 20m zone cost us the 2nd try.

We had players out injured for sure but so did they. I honestly beleive the team we had out was good enough to win which shows we are pretty decent depth wise.

I know I'll have the pies responding to what I'm about to say but I don't care and Im being honest -

I don't think Wigan are good team. I don't tnink they will give us any problems later down the line. Their pack is ok but they have no halves to trouble big teams in big games. I now sol was out and he makes big difference but Imo Wigan won't win the grand final and they ain't a patch on the Wigan of last year.

I thought the effort and commitment was first class yesterday. To be without Lomax, Percival, Burns, Walsh, Wilkin and Vea before the game and then to lose Greenwood after 15 minutes and Wellens at half time, so effectively just had 2 subs to rotate was a remarkable effort to come so close.

When we get anything like a fully fit team on the park we'll be very difficult to beat and it's simply key injuries and the volume of injuries that is crippling us at the moment.

I didn't think Saints were a good team last year but they won the GF and won it without recognised halves that would trouble big teams! At this point in the season Wigan are not playing as well as last year for sure but they will certainly improve. The question is by how much and only time will tell? I also think that you need to factor in the fact that Saints are defending much better than last year. Wigan found it very difficult to break their defence down yesterday. Wigan's attack is not as fluent as last year yet but a good defence stops a good attack! Also Wigan's defence was good yesterday and so don't assume that if Saints had their recognised halves that the result would have been different. Maybe later in the season when both teams have players back then some of these questions will be answered.

Apart from the ifs buts and maybes, yesterday's game was a good tough game of rugby that could have gone either way. Isn't that want we all want to see and is what will keep species coming through the turnstiles?

I took a friend to the game who supports Gloucester RU and he really enjoyed the contest, intensity and atmosphere. He said that watching RL live he appreciated how tough, fit and skillful the players are.

In all seriousness, on the day, Wigan were better than us, and deserved to win. We put up a very brave fight and the effort was top drawer. Last year when we lost, we often disgraced ourselves. This year when we lose, we go down fighting, which is pleasing. I'm not too downbeat as I don't believe any player on that field (for either side) could have given any more. Trophies aren't won on Good Friday and if we ever get a full strength side on the pitch, we can beat anyone!

Line drawn in line with the ptb (37/38m) and another 10 metres from it (47/48m). Note the ball is already in the hands of the dummy half by this point so the defence have set off with their first step. Likewise Phil Bentham has evidently started moving backwards anticipating the kick. Mossop (2nd man right of Bentham) looks onside for me, we can see he's moving so would have been a fraction further back when the foot touched the ball. Manfredi (furthest man to the right of Bentham) is nearly 20 metres back from the ptb! In fact the only players I'd say would definitely have been offside there when the foot touched the ball are Farrell (on the floor behind the ptb) and Williams (2nd man on the left of Bentham) but neither gets involved. BTW the yellow arrow on your screen is actually pointing at Gelling not Manfredi.

Williams didn't get involved as Saints passed left. Despite his body positioning on this frame he actually stands still whilst the rest of the line moves up, presumably anticipating running downfield after the ball is kicked. The error comes because Hohaia gets the pass and wastes time with a poor dummy to Thompson which the defence didn't buy at all. Turner gets the ball with about 7 metres between him and Mossop, who has had three seconds to build up some speed. There are no blockers and Turner doesn't have the presence of mind to step (a centre should be able to shimmy round a prop, and there was plenty space either side of him) or just take the tackle (it was 4th). Instead he takes a two or three steps forward in taking his kick, by which time Mossop is right on top of him.
